This striking glazed terracotta jar/vase combines a brutalist silhouette with a vibrant cerulean or turquoise blue hue.
Dramatic silhouette and vivid color complement a variety of decorating styles.
Displayed on its own or alongside other jars and vases, this piece brings captivating color and classic shapes to the home space.
Crackle finish
Hole at base for water drainage
DIMENSIONS: H 7 x W 10 x D 8 inch
